I took my nclex yesterday and the test shut off at 75 questions. I did the PVT and got the good- pop up and am still getting the good pop-up. I'm still skeptical about it, I will feel better once I know for sure.

That test was rough. I felt like I knew nothing. I calmed myself down and used my test taking strategies when I had no clue on what the correct answer was. I looked up 5 questions that I could remember and found that I answered 4/5 correctly using my test taking strategies. Everything else is a blur.

This am I just got a job offer. It was not from the place I had hoped for but in this economy and with jobs for new grads being so scarce I will most likely take it. I still need to talk it over with my hubby though. (Now if I could just know for sure that I passed the nclex).

Some advice that I can lend is know your infection protocols and priority info. Use the test taking strategies that are provided with every nclex prep book. I used kaplan from 2007-2008 and davis's q & a. I found that these strategies are what helped me when I was lost which was 98% of the time. I think it took me 1hr 45min to complete the test @75 questions. I was on a math problem for about 25 min ( I had a black-out moment and it took awhile 25 min. exactly for me to recover).

My BON does participate in quick results but I also know of some people who were able to see their license # after 24 hr of taking their test. I hope I'm one of them if not I should know for sure by Saturday. In the mean time i will continue to do the PVT.
